UNPFII - The Elders Are Always Willing To Teach
from Indigenous Rights Radio · host Cultural Survival
The theme of the twenty-second session of the UNPFII will be “Indigenous Peoples, human health, planetary and territorial health, and climate change: a rights-based approach”. Cultural Survival attended the conference and spoke to some of the delegates who attended. Produced by Avexnim Cojti (Maya K'iche) and Shaldon Ferris (Khoisan) Interviewee: Starlett Beardy (Pimicikamak Cree Nation ) Image: Cultural Survival Music "Canmandalla" by Yarina, used with permission.
